    I use the one for weather channel. You can figure out the address.

    We are not supposed to put the websites on the posts.

    For road conditions, I usually google Illinois Road Conditions. Or whatever state you want. It will give the current conditions.

    Take your pick :yes2557:

    http://www.fhwa.dot.gov/trafficinfo/

    Complete with live cam feeds, accident/incident markers. Road construction issues, road conditions and closures.

    Everything you could possibly need, except a radar map.
